A scientist is creating different waves in laboratory . if she doubled the frequency of a wave while keeping the wave speed cons

tant , what happens to the wavelength of the wave?
a. it doubles
b. it is halved
c. there is no change
d. it quadruples
Biology
1 answer:
V125BC [204]4 years ago
7 0

Answer:

B. Halved.

Explanation:

Frequency and wavelength have an inverse relationship in such a way that When a wavelength is increased, frequency and the energy in this scenario tends to decrease and the converse is true.

In a certain plant, yellow leaves are dominant and red leaves are recessive. A plant with genotype Yy and a plant with Yy are cr
Tanzania [10]

Answer:

One offspring would have red leaves.

Explanation:

Given

Yellow leaves are dominant and red leaves are recessive

Let us assume that the trait of Yellow color of a leaf be  represented by "Y"

and the trait of red color of a leaf be  represented by "y"

When two parent of genotype "Yy" are crossed with each other, the following offsprings are produced as shown in the punnet square below

Y y

Y YY Yy

y Yy yy

Total four offpsrings are produced out of which only one has red leave as red color is a recessive trait and it will appear only when both the allele in a cell are of red color.

Thus, one offspring would have red leaves.
